Output 90af099665450ca5916fe3e6f36e01622975400132d0018c3bb3cc484d6777a1:0

value
64662604
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5c33708907bf259e927838d43c0c9a31132b834 OP_EQUALVERIFY OP_CHECKSIG
address
1K2fyZm1GHMZBrgyZFoS8FjgfhTGqWHAar
transaction
90af099665450ca5916fe3e6f36e01622975400132d0018c3bb3cc484d6777a1
spent
true